Transaction 92040afedc30fd81b81e9d33803f431a4aa7ed2669ec9870f17204cbfaea5129

218 Input
2 Outputs
  • 92040afedc30fd81b81e9d33803f431a4aa7ed2669ec9870f17204cbfaea5129:0
  • value  3180000000
    address  17xjhpLbLsSCVWf4d5SSgVBUKpECreNp4F
  • 92040afedc30fd81b81e9d33803f431a4aa7ed2669ec9870f17204cbfaea5129:1
  • value  1000014
    address  1LmWeGYwyp76wpQFwdkGH3j951FoKc2rGb